The La Quinta Inn & Suites Rancho Cordova is a 3 Star, Quality Excellence Award Winning hotel, conveniently located off Highway 50 and Sunrise Blvd. We have 130 beautifully decorated guestrooms, and newly renovated lobby, front desk, lounge, and atrium. All guestrooms have hair dryers, irons and boards, coffee, and Lodgenet movie system. The Hotel offers a complimentary deluxe continental breakfast daily, free high speed internet access, and has an outside pool and spa, fitness room and coin operated laundry. Brookfields Restaurant, located in our parking lot, offers breakfast, lunch and dinner and provides our room service. We have 4 meeting rooms and can accommodate 5 to 100 people. Okay, first of all I have to admit this was a last-minute Express Deal booking via Priceline, but we did encounter a few "issues" that we normally don't run into. First of all, please note these types of bookings do NOT guarantee any room preferences (e.g. non-smoking, etc.) After making the reservation online the night prior to our arrival, we called the hotel directly and requested a non-smoking room. They made note; however, neglected to conveniently remind us that they do not guarantee that with Priceline Express Deal bookings. When we showed up to check in, they could not give us the two double-bed, non-smoking room we reserved. If we wanted a non-smoking room, we would have to accept a single double bed two doors down from the main lobby. The clerk's attitude was very matter-of-fact and inflexible, and on the verge of being sarcastic. (From other reviews, this is their modus operandi!) It's a good thing we ALWAYS travel with a AeroBed! As for the room, it was cramped, even with only one bed. There was only one pillow?! There was hair in the shower from the previous guest waiting for us, too. Again, we were desperate, but given an choice, I'll drive out to Folsom to stay and drive back to Rancho Cordova if need be. Airport & Shuttle Information - La Quinta Inn & Suites Rancho Cordova
Sacramento Intl Airport:Take I-5 South to Highway 50 East, Exit Sunrise Blvd and turn right on Folsom Blvd. Hotel is on the right. Super Shuttle is approximately $24 one way; Taxi is approximately $55 one way
Airport Shuttle? Sorry, no airport shuttle available.
